subroutine zlarfg (integer n, complex*16 alpha, complex*16, dimension( * ) x, integer incx, complex*16 tau)

ZLARFG generates an elementary reflector (Householder matrix).  

Purpose:

 ZLARFG generates a complex elementary reflector H of order n, such
 that

       H**H * ( alpha ) = ( beta ),   H**H * H = I.
              (   x   )   (   0  )

 where alpha and beta are scalars, with beta real, and x is an
 (n-1)-element complex vector. H is represented in the form

       H = I - tau * ( 1 ) * ( 1 v**H ) ,
                     ( v )

 where tau is a complex scalar and v is a complex (n-1)-element
 vector. Note that H is not hermitian.

 If the elements of x are all zero and alpha is real, then tau = 0
 and H is taken to be the unit matrix.

 Otherwise  1 <= real(tau) <= 2  and  abs(tau-1) <= 1 .
Parameters

N

          N is INTEGER
          The order of the elementary reflector.

ALPHA

          ALPHA is COMPLEX*16
          On entry, the value alpha.
          On exit, it is overwritten with the value beta.

X

          X is COMPLEX*16 array, dimension
                         (1+(N-2)*abs(INCX))
          On entry, the vector x.
          On exit, it is overwritten with the vector v.

INCX

          INCX is INTEGER
          The increment between elements of X. INCX > 0.

TAU

          TAU is COMPLEX*16
          The value tau.
